Output efc1a6b9995238e7e7d54a37db9fc089ce8e58b15d1143ea31c79e80dfbd0f61:1

value
659054982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16dde32ffdd78ee74925f37d9ec6cedb896f6061 OP_EQUAL
address
33mvbmsLNAmkqvrMGEWzhoWxknpqUa2ZEZ
transaction
efc1a6b9995238e7e7d54a37db9fc089ce8e58b15d1143ea31c79e80dfbd0f61
spent
true